Business Tourism - Exhibition park

This exceptional tool, which had been lacking up till now, will give a new boost to business tourism, not only in the Alpes-Maritimes, but throughout the Provence-Alpes-Côte d’Azur region as well.

 

An international dimension

The future exhibition park will enrich the business tourism equipment offer (with the likes of the Nice Acropolis convention center), which has made the French Riviera a key location for leading events. With its large dimensions (75 000 m2), and flexible, adjustable design, this major project is destined to host a range of European and international events of all sizes: trade fares and exhibitions, congresses, seminars, professional gatherings… Set on the location of the current MIN (Market of National Interest)- it will be only two steps away from the Nice Côte d’Azur airport and the future Nice-St Augustin-Airport multimodal hub, (in particular, the future railway station).

 

An opportunity for business tourism

Thanks to this new economic tool, new companies linked to business tourism will be launched within the Nice Côte d’Azur metropolis, with jobs created in such areas as events management and communication, specialized manpower, stands and promotional materials for exhibitions… On a broader scale, an increase in business tourism will impact a whole range of local activities from hotels and restaurants, to logistics, to transport services. At “full cruise”, this initiative should have an important impact on the region, injecting 750 million euros/year into the local economy, representing some 9 million euros/year in fiscal revenue. The Grand Arénas operation has anticipated the new exhibition park’s success: The first phase will be built on 75 000 m2 , with a possible extension, in the second phase, of up to 30 000 m2.
